Oral Screening
Oral cancer screening is routinely carried out at every dental examination. The hard and soft tissues of the mouth are thoroughly checked for any sign of abnormality. See our feature on oral cancer on the 'Oral Health' page.

Tooth Whitening
Teeth may become discoloured in a number of ways, for example through age, tobacco use or the consumption of certain foods and beverages. Simple tooth brushing, even with special toothpastes, will do little to whiten teeth. Professional cleaning by a dentist or hygienist will help, by removing superficial staining, but will not result in you regaining that youthful look!

Scientific studies have shown however, that certain tooth whitening treatments are safe and effective at whitening teeth. We offer these treatments at our practice and after an initial session in the surgery to kick-start the process, patients are able to continue with the treatment in their own homes.

This treatment involves using custom made bleaching trays filled with a bleaching gel and we will show you how to use the product to achieve the best results. You will control the final shade of your teeth, from one to several shades lighter. Tooth whitening does not normally involve any pain, although some transient sensitivity may be experienced. The full treatment usually takes 2 to 6 weeks.

Crowns, Bridges, Veneers and Implants

Crowns
Porcelain or porcelain bonded to metal give full coverage to teeth weakened by old fillings, decay or fractures and they can also be used to improve appearance.

Bridges
These are used to replace gaps caused by lost teeth and use porcelain bonded to a metal structure. The 'bridge' is supported by the teeth either side of the gap, and these teeth usually require some preparation.

Veneers
Veneers are thin porcelain covers that are fixed to the front of cosmetically poor teeth using adhesive dentistry, and can make a dramatic improvement to visual appearance.

Implants
Dental implants are growing in popularity and represent an alternative way of replacing lost or cosmetically poor teeth. A titanium 'post' is inserted into the jaw and this supports the 'new' tooth.
